Among the factors which affect the performance characteristics of a pneumatic ejector, the effect of the distance α' from the nozzle exit section to the entrance of the parallel part of the mixing tube was experimentally dealt with in the present paper. It was found that the optimum distance α' for the highest vacuum and the highest ejector efficiency was α'=15mm, so long as the present ranges of experiments were concerned. As the inner diameter e of the parallel part of the mixing tube was selected as e=9.55mm, the optimum value above-mentioned yields to α'/e=1.57, which coincides with the results obtained previously by L.J. Kastner, J.R. Spooner for a pneumatic ejector. Besides, the present authors have measured the pressure distributions in the mixing tube, the results of which were compared with the theories by W. Tollmien and A.M. Kuethe. Further, the results of the present paper were compared with the results hitherto published for steam ejectors.
